Job Title: Title Real Estate Reader/Title Reviewer
Job Description:
As a Title Real Estate Reader,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the accuracy and completeness of property titles. Your responsibilities will include verifying the complete history of a property's title by examining public records to identify any claims, liens, encumbrances, or other issues that may affect ownership. You will prepare closing statements, HUD-1 forms, and other necessary paperwork, clear title defects, obtain necessary approvals, and ensure all parties are informed about the closing process. Additionally, you will manage the ordering of payoffs, lien searches, and estoppel letters, and handle the disbursement of funds during the closing process.
